Sumario:This research has aimed to develop a method of immobilizing cells to allow regeneration of the coenzyme (NADH) with a suitable co-substrate to carry out the reduction of Acetophenone with good yields. To this solid growth through three Ascomycetes (filamentous fungi) Gongronella butleri, Diplogelasinospora grovesii and Monascus kaoliang determined, being the latter which grew more biomass production. Monascus kaoliang was employed as a biocatalyst for testing immobilization with the Union method supports by Adsorption, with the intention of finding better derivative immobilized, productivity, performance, maximum conversion, conversion, initial velocity was evaluated. For coenzyme regeneration was tested with two co-substrates glucose and isopropanol. The results obtained in the laboratory can determine that derivatives immobilized in polyurethane foams using glucose as co-substrate are good support to carry out the reduction process acetophenone since given its high porosity cells are exposed to the reaction medium without problems diffusional within the matrix. In this regard, the bioreducciones are a useful tool in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and fine chemicals. Furthermore, only a small number of fungi have been described as good producers reductases.
